What is Surface Grinder? Surface Grinding Machine: Types, Parts & Working Process :- A surface grinder consists of an abrasive wheel, a chuck (a workplace holding device) and a rotary table. The surface grinder is generally used for finishing the work-piece or the object. The main use of the surface grinder is in the finishing process.

Milling Machine Definition: The milling machine is a type of machine which removes the material from the workpiece by feeding the work past a rotating multipoint cutter.The metal removal rate is higher very high as the cutter has a high speed and many cutting edges. The turning process works with a lathe machine moving the cutting tool in a linear motion along the surface of the rotating workpiece, removing material around the circumference until the desired diameter is achieved, to machine cylindrical parts with external and internal features, such as slots, tapers, and threads.
